Prom Season is here!

To be sure, the Prom season is upon us.  Beware of Gypsy operators waiting to pray on the innocent.  While researching your choice of limousine companies that will be transporting your valuable cargo, please check for the legality of the company.
You might try asking the following questions:
What is your PSC # ? (Registered with MD Public Service Commission)   (Public Service has a website that you can check on each company) How much insurance do you carry? (should be at least $300,000) Are your Chauffeurs Public Service certified? (carries a PSC license)  Do you follow the guidelines of the rules of the Prom Promise?
                                                
If the company that you have contacted on the phone has answered "no" to any of the above questions, you can be sure that they are not operating a legal business.  Continue to search for the company that can comply with all of your questions.

It is always a good idea to ask to view the vehicle prior to placing your deposit.  Some companies advertise vehicles on their websites that they do not physically own.  Therefore, relying on an outside company to have that vehicle available for your reservation.  Over-bookings and Cancellations from the limousine companies that conduct their business in this manner is not uncommon.  More often than not, you are left with no vehicle for your Prom.

Do your research; don't be afraid to ask questions; and make smart choices before giving out your credit card information.  Here is hoping that all will experience a safe and happy Prom evening.
